What Cleveland Has to Offer:

The Greater Cleveland Area is home to 2.8 million people and offers a wide variety of communities. Cleveland boasts a wealth of cultural resources, entertainment options, and leisure activities, including a vibrant Lake Erie shoreline and Metro Parks system. The parks are connected by the Cuyahoga Valley National Park, with an additional 33,000 acres, 100 miles of trails, and camping sites. The Playhouse Square theatre district hosts over 1,000 events annually across nine theatres, making it the country's largest performing arts center outside of New York City. Cleveland also features the Cleveland Symphony Orchestra, outstanding museums such as the Cleveland Museum of Art and Rock and Roll Hall of Fame, numerous music venues, and professional sports teams (Browns, Cavaliers, Guardians, and Monsters). A Brief Overview

Provides and manages direct medical evaluation, diagnosis, procedures, and care for patients within a recognized area of practice or for a specific patient population.

What You Will Do
  • Provide and manage direct patient care, including physical examinations, evaluations, assessments, diagnoses, and treatments for a specified patient population.
  • Prescribe pharmaceuticals, medications, and treatment regimens as appropriate to assessed medical conditions.
  • Refer patients to specialists and relevant care components as needed.
  • Train and supervise medical students and residents engaged in specialty activities and procedures, as appropriate.
  • Manage the daily operations of a specific medical program, patient care unit, or research function, if applicable.
  • Coordinate patient care activities of nursing and support staff as required.
  • Follow departmental policies, procedures, and objectives, including continuous quality improvement, safety, environmental, and infection control standards.
  • Participate in health promotion, education, and prevention programs as appropriate.
  • Maintain departmental productivity thresholds.
  • Maintain faculty status in good standing with the CWRU SOM, if applicable.
  • Adhere to core physician obligations outlined in the Physician Policy Manual.
